Mini brushless motors are small devices that help make things move. They are found in many products we use every day, like toys, drones, and even some tools. These motors  are different from regular motors because they don’t have  brushes. Brushes are parts that can wear out and need replacing. Mini brushless motors are more efficient and last  longer, making them a popular choice for many companies. Sometimes, mini  brushless motors  can have problems. One common  issue  is overheating. When a motor  gets too hot, it  can stop working or even break. This usually happens when the motor is  used for too long without a break. To fix this, it’s important to give  the motor time to cool down. Using good cooling systems, like fans or heat  sinks, can help keep the temperature down. Another problem is that these  motors can vibrate a lot. This can make things noisy or even lead to damage. Make sure to balance the motor well during installation. If it shakes too much,  it can wear out faster. Also, some people may  not know how to connect the motor  properly. It’s essential  to follow the instructions carefully when  setting up a mini brushless motor. If you get  lost, looking up videos or guides can help. Using mini brushless motors in consumer electronics has many  advantages. First, they are very energy-efficient. This  means they use less power to work, which helps save energy and money. Devices that have these motors can run longer on batteries, which is great for things like remote  controls and handheld gadgets. Another benefit is their small size. Mini brushless motors can fit into  tight spaces, making them perfect for small devices. For example, in smartphones, these motors help with vibration alerts and camera  focusing. They are also very quiet compared to other motors, which is important for devices that need to  be silent,  like in hearing aids. Mini brushless motors are small but powerful devices that help robots and automated  machines work better and faster. These motors use magnets and electricity to spin without needing brushes, which are parts that can wear out. Because they do not have brushes,  mini brushless motors can last longer and run  more smoothly. This  means that robots can move more precisely and do their jobs without stopping often for repairs.  For example, in factories, mini brushless motors can move parts on a conveyor belt quickly and quietly. This helps workers save  time and increases production.
